Hogmanay

New Year In Scotland

December 31st is the official holiday all over Scotland as it is the New Year's Eve or the Hogmanay. New Year in Scotland is celebrated with fervor and enthusiasm on January 1st. Hogmanay is also called 'night of the candle'. The idea of celebrating Hogmanay dates back to the pagan celebrations of the winter solstice. These celebrations were inherited from the Vikings who celebrated Yule in the medieval period.
